Handover: PedalShift rebalancer. You're taking over from me (Darو—ignore that, Daro). Tool pulls dock occupancy from the Citygrid feed every 5 min, scores stations, emits van routes. Cron lives on the ops box, not CI. Known issues: route solver times out on holidays; just rerun. Don't touch the weighting model without asking Priya on the Velora team. Logs rotate weekly. Everything else is self-explanatory once you read main.py. The current production configuration values are listed below.

settings of fajop-fahap:
[holeth]
port = 9300
team = juleth
host = holeth.tolvaqsoft.example
region = south-4
access_code = ac_4bcdf6
timeout_ms = 500

TURN-208: Gatevale turnstile counters at the Merrow Field pilot double-count when a rotation reverses mid-cycle. Attendance totals drift roughly 2% high per event. The debounce window fix is implemented, reviewed by Ilsa, and soak-tested across two simulated match days without drift. Ready for your cut; the candidate build is identified below.

trace token, tagag-tafog: htk6_5ed18c

- [ ] Key ceremony step 7: verify Tollgate's idempotency-key store before enabling payment retries. Replay the last 50 declined charges in staging; confirm zero duplicates. If the dedup index is cold, warm it first. Do not proceed until the audit log shows a clean pass. On-call must then unseal the retry signer with the recovery passphrase that follows.

vault phrase of yagag-kadup = belael-druius-rusax-kelox

Escalation: If the Merrow dedupe job flags more than 2% of customer records as conflicting merges, pause the pipeline before the nightly Ledgerline export runs. Do not force-merge records with mismatched billing regions; these require manual review by the Data Stewardship rotation. Document every override in the merge audit log. If stewardship is unreachable within two hours, escalate to the address below.

escalation mailbox, bafog-fafog: ulador@paliqlabs.internal